Welcome aboard! You'll be working on SquatHawk, our typo-squatting package scanner at Fernbrook Labs. It crawls the registry mirror hourly, compares new package names against our protected list using edit-distance heuristics, and flags anything suspicious to the triage queue. Most of your work will be in the matcher module — ask Priya on the tooling channel if you get stuck. To run the scanner locally, copy env.sample to .env and fill in the basics. The scanner also needs its registry token, so add this line to your .env:

secret setting of yajog-taguf: ARCHIVE_KEY3=051

Release checklist — Widegap diff viewer. Verify streaming mode on files over 500 MB: memory must stay under 1 GB, scroll stays responsive, syntax highlighting degrades gracefully past the threshold. Run the Ledgerstone fixture set before sign-off. Do not ship if chunk boundaries split multibyte characters. Record the verified build token below.

pipeline stamp: htk3_69f

If builds fail with signature-expiry or cache-staleness errors, suspect clock skew first. Each agent syncs against the internal time service in the Hollowgate datacenter; drift beyond two seconds trips the skew alarm. Check the agent's last sync timestamp before restarting anything — a forced resync on a loaded agent can invalidate in-flight artifact signatures. If drift is confirmed, quarantine the agent, resync, and verify twice before returning it to the pool. The time sync daemon uses the following configuration.

settings of fajop-fahap:
[holeth]
port = 9300
team = juleth
host = holeth.tolvaqsoft.example
region = south-4
access_code = ac_4bcdf6
timeout_ms = 500

The renewal of our three-year agreement with Torvane Materials has been assessed in detail. Proposed terms include a 4.2% unit-price increase, partially offset by improved volume rebates and extended payment terms of sixty days. Sensitivity analysis indicates a net annual cost impact of under 1% on the Meridia product line, assuming stable demand. Legal has flagged no material changes to liability clauses. We recommend approval, subject to the conditions outlined in the confidential note below.

confidential, yawip-bahif: Zorokox Partners plans to lower the Casax list price by 28.0 percent in April. The board signed off on a budget of $271.0 million for Project Juldor. The renewal with Pelokox Partners closes at $410.1 million a year, 3.4 percent below the last contract. Project Pelok slips by a full year because of the audit delay.